The aroma is a bit sour, almost muscat-like if I had to guess. In the mouth, there is a slightly tangy gas feeling with smooth umami and acidity. The umami spreads gradually, and the acidity accentuates and tightens the taste, which gradually fades away.
It is dry and light among the Akabusu, and is a delicious sake with a summery sweet and sour taste.
